Different femoral tunnel placement in posterior cruciate ligament reconstruction: a finite element analysis
BACKGROUND: At present, there is no consensus on the optimal biomechanical method for Posterior cruciate ligament (PCL) reconstruction, and the “critical corner” that is produced by the femoral tunnel is currently considered to be one of the main reasons for PCL failure.
